I firstly went to IVF Aust, I don't have issues with the nurses there but I do have a problem with my FS. I don't find him empathy enought and it seems that everytime in our precious 1 hour consultation (which cost me a lot), he is more interested in his Japan skiing experience than my ovary.

So I changed to SIVF. We have done 2 stim cycles now with Dr. Mark Livingstone and he is wonderful. I also think the nurses there are brilliant, very thorough, professional and caring.

I also heard that SIVF has higher standard/or tighter guildlines than most clinics technically as well, for example, their standard transfer is 5-day blastcyst to ensure the quality of the embyros while other clinics can do 2 or 3 day embyros. Their guildline for sperm analysis is also the toughest for motility, morphology and counts. My husband's morphology tested at IVF Aust was 46% normal and it dropped a lot when we re-tested in SIVF.

That's just my personal story/opinion, not neccesarily to say the SIVF is better than IVF Aust (I heard lots of great things about Dr.S from IVF Aust). So I guess it is about what you feel comfortable with, whether you have chemistry with the particular person you are seeing.
